Notes made by Izaak Walton Size:L: 90 x 60cm View of houses in AustinNotes made by Izaak Walton, c1662. Entries made on the fly leaf of a copy of The Book of Common Prayer, recording the births of three of his children and the deaths of Rachel Floud, his first wife, 22nd August 1640, and Anne Ken his second wife, 17th April 1662, with a draft of the latter's epitaph in Worcester Cathedral.
